3 Tips to Increase the Value of Your Holiday Home

The only way to do good business with your holiday home is to offer something extra than your competitors. Since most guests look for added benefits that are offered at a competitive price, they get attracted towards your property increasing the bookings. Well, fortunately, there are simple and easy ways to add more value to your property and make more money than your competitors. Here are top tips to increase the value of your holiday home. 1. Keep outdoors clean to make your holiday home tidy If you do not maintain the outdoor area of your holiday home, you are less likely to get frequent bookings. Since the guests would predict how clean and decorated your interiors are just by looking at the gate and surrounding garden, it is extremely important to keep it clean and beautiful. Clean up any dust and debris from the main entrance. Also, try some gardening and landscaping to make the area more presentable and attractive. Never forget to trim the grasses. You may invest in a lawn mower to keep your garden clean and well maintained. 2. De-clutter the entire area to increase its value To increase the value of your property and get more bookings, you must de-clutter the entire area. Check out every nook and corner for things that are no more required. If you feel something is taking up more space, its time to get it removed. Do not pile up mattresses, bed covers, and other stuff just anywhere. Have a separate room to sort them out. If you have small rooms, it is important not to store anything that may make it look untidy. Remember, having essentials in the room is more important to the guests than having large showpieces. You may add cabinets that can be easily made with the help of raw material and a few power tools such as a hand saw and a power drill. 3. Renovate interiors to attract more guests The best way to decorate your interiors is to keep your rooms, bathrooms, and kitchen functional. A regular maintenance check will help you to find out areas that require repairs. Have a toolbox handy with basic tools such as hammers, screwdrivers and some power tools. It will greatly help you to fix certain problems instantly. With such tools, you may renovate your bathrooms by changing fixtures and even do plumbing work. Upgrading kitchen is also a great way that can be done to make it more tidy and functional. Since the kitchen is the main part of your holiday home, a clean and upgraded kitchen will attract more bookings. Conclusion In addition to the above tips, you may also paint your walls with soothing colors to increase the value of your holiday home. It is recommended to use lighter shades and tones of paint. It can help make any room appear larger than it is by creating an illusion of bigger space. Never use bold colors on your walls as it may not be comforting to some guest and they may not want to stay in your holiday home. You may also add mirrors in the lobby, reception area, and bathrooms to create an illusion of more space while decorating your interiors on a budget.
